Lithuania’s Ambassador presents her letters of credence to President of China
On 14 December, the Ambassador of Lithuania in China Ina Marčiulionytė presented her letters of credence to the President of China Xi Jinping.
After the ceremony, the Ambassador and the President of China held a meeting, during which Marčiulionytė stressed that the next year marked the 25th anniversary of diplomatic relations between Lithuania and China. On this occasion, both countries plan to hold a lot of events and implement many projects, which will further enhance bilateral economic, commercial and cultural ties. The two sides also underlined new opportunities for expanding bilateral cooperation through the implementation of China’s ‘One Belt, One Road’ initiative and projects between China and 16 Central and Eastern European countries.
Marčiulionytė is the 5th Ambassador of Lithuania, who resides in Beijing. Lithuania and China established diplomatic relations on 14 September 1991.
